# Edit a Company Resource

## Purpose

Use this guide to update an existing company resource.

## Before you start

* The resource must already exist.
* You must have permission to edit company resources.

## How to get there

1. Sign in to Compassly.
2. Select **Company resources**.

## Steps

1. Find the company resource you want to update.
2. Open the **Action** menu for that row.
3. Select **Edit resource**.
4. In the **Edit company resource** window, update any of the available fields:
   * **Team members**
   * **Link name**
   * **Link**
5. Select **Update**.

## Notes

* The same validation rules used during creation also apply during editing.
* Resource titles remain case-insensitive.
* The edited resource title must still be unique.

## Role differences

* **Super Admin, Admin, Supervisor:** Can edit company resources.
* **Clinician, Basic:** Can view resources, but cannot edit them.

## What happens next

After the update is saved, the resource stays in the company resources list with the new information.
